Mrs. Reagan will be buried at the Ronald Reagan Presidential Library in Simi Valley, California, next to her husband, Ronald Wilson Reagan, who died on June 5, 2004.

She was married to former president Ronald Reagan for 52 years, and joined him in the White House for eight years from 1981 to 1989.
